ITP tarayıcılarda One Tap desteği

Intelligent Tracking Prevention (ITP) nedeniyle, iOS'teki Chrome, Safari ve FireFox gibi ITP tarayıcıları için ek bir sıcak karşılama sayfası gösterilir. Bu değişiklikle birlikte, One Tap kullanıcı deneyimi birden çok platformda çalışıyor ve böylece hem kullanıcılar hem de geliştiriciler için tutarlı bir deneyim sağlıyor.

data-itp_support özelliğini ayarlayarak ITP'de One Tap kullanıcı deneyiminin etkinleştirilip etkinleştirilmeyeceğini kontrol edebilirsiniz.

Katılma

One Tap on ITP tarayıcılarında, açık bir şekilde devre dışı bırakılmamış tüm web siteleri için varsayılan olarak etkindir.

Bu özelliği devre dışı bırakmak için aşağıdaki snippet'te gösterildiği gibi kodunuza data-itp_support="false" ekleyebilirsiniz:

<div id="g_id_onload"
     data-client_id="YOUR_GOOGLE_CLIENT_ID"
     data-itp_support="false"
     data-login_uri="https://your.domain/your_login_endpoint">
</div>

Ürünü daha sonra ya da tamamen sizin kontrol ettiğiniz bir yüzde oranında kullanıma sunmak istemeniz iyi bir örnek olabilir. Bu durumda, şimdi kapsam dışında kalmayı seçebilir ve daha sonra devre dışı bırakma işlemini kendi denetiminiz altında kaldırabilirsiniz.

Önemli kullanıcı yolculukları

Kullanıcı yolculukları aşağıdaki durumlara göre değişiklik gösterir.

  • Google web sitelerindeki oturum durumu. Kullanıcı yolculuğu başladığında farklı bir Google oturumu durumunu göstermek için aşağıdaki terimler kullanılır.

    • Has-Google-session: Google web sitelerinde en az bir etkin oturum vardır.
    • Google oturumu yok: Google web sitelerinde etkin bir oturum yoktur.
  • Kullanıcı yolculuğu başladığında seçilen Google Hesabının web sitenizi onaylayıp onaylamadığı. Aşağıdaki terimler, farklı onay durumlarını belirtmek için kullanılmıştır.

    • Yeni kullanıcı: Seçilen hesap web sitenizi onaylamadı.
    • Geri gelen kullanıcı: Seçili hesap web sitenizi daha önce onayladı.

Has-Google oturumu yeni kullanıcı yolculuğu

  1. Karşılama sayfası.

    Sıcak Karşılama Sayfası

  2. Hesap seçici sayfası.

    İlk Oturumda Hesap Seçici Sayfası Var

  3. Yeni kullanıcı izni sayfası.

    Google ile oturum açma düğmesi izni ve oturum açma.

  4. Kullanıcı onayladıktan sonra web sitenizle bir kimlik jetonu paylaşılır.

    Kullanıcılar, Başka bir hesap kullan düğmesini tıklayarak yeni bir Google oturumu ekleyebilir. Aşağıdaki Google oturumu yok kullanıcı yolculuklarına bakın.

Google oturumunda geri gelen kullanıcı yolculuğu var

  1. Karşılama sayfası.

    Sıcak Karşılama Sayfası

  2. Hesap seçici sayfası.

    Google Hesabı seçici

  3. Kullanıcı geri gelen bir hesabı seçtikten sonra, web sitenizle bir kimlik jetonu paylaşılır.

    Kullanıcılar, Başka bir hesap kullan düğmesini tıklayarak yeni bir Google oturumu ekleyebilir. Aşağıdaki Google oturumu yok kullanıcı yolculuklarına bakın.

Google oturumu olmayan yeni kullanıcı yolculuğu

  1. Karşılama sayfası.

    Sıcak Karşılama Sayfası

  2. Yeni bir Google oturumu eklenecek ilk sayfa.

    Google Hesabı E-postası

  3. Yeni bir Google oturumu eklemek için ikinci sayfa.

    Google Hesabı&#39;nda oturum açma

  4. Yeni kullanıcı izni sayfası.

    Google ile oturum açma düğmesi izni ve oturum açma.

  5. Kullanıcı onayladıktan sonra web sitenizle bir kimlik jetonu paylaşılır.

Google oturumu olmayan geri gelen kullanıcı yolculuğu

  1. Karşılama sayfası.

    Sıcak Karşılama Sayfası

  2. Yeni bir Google oturumu eklenecek ilk sayfa.

    Google Hesabı E-postası

  3. Yeni bir Google oturumu eklemek için ikinci sayfa.

    Google Hesabı&#39;nda oturum açma

  4. Kullanıcı İleri düğmesini tıkladıktan sonra web sitenizle bir kimlik jetonu paylaşılır.